Patchfox
Patchfox is a Secure Scuttlebutt client. It is used in combination with a local Secure Scuttlebutt server/daemon running on your local machine.
What is Patchfox?
Patchfox is a Firefox add-on that serves as a client for Secure Scuttlebutt, an offline-first peer-to-peer decentralized platform. It forms a global cryptographic social network with its peers, allowing users to publish and follow signed messages.

Summary
Patchfox is a client for Secure Scuttlebutt decentralized platform. Secure Scuttlebutt is an offline-first peer to peer decentralized platform that is fostering a more humane social graph. It forms a global cryptographic social network with its peers. Each user is identified by a public key, and publishes a log of signed messages, which other users follow socially. Patchfox is a client for this network.
